The first step in getting your learner permit is to submit the required documentation to the DMV. This includes proof of identity, age, and residency. Also, mouse click the next document must pass an eye test and pass the written test. The test is a 20 question multiple choice test that covers road laws, signs and safe driving techniques. To pass, you must answer at minimum 14 questions correctly. You can prepare for the test by taking online practice tests or guides that go over the rules and regulations for driving of your state.
Once you have all the necessary documents, you are able to schedule an appointment with your local DMV office to take the test. Online reservations are available at a variety of offices, which can make the process faster. This will ensure that all paperwork is completed prior to your visit.
You can also take a driver education course to prepare for the written test. These classes are usually offered by private driving schools, colleges, or high schools. They usually combine classroom instruction with behind-the-wheel training. Although these courses aren't obligatory, they can help you gain the experience and confidence to be successful on the road.
Once you have passed the written knowledge test you can begin driving under supervision. During this period, you'll need to be in the company of an adult driver at all times you drive. Additionally, you should keep a record of all your driving practice, including the date, duration, and what type of driving you've experienced. Before you apply for a permit, study the New York Motorcycle Manual and become familiar with the New York driving rules. You must also take a written test of knowledge that will comprise of 20 multiple-choice questions about road signs and motorcycles. You can take the test online or in-person at a DMV office. To receive a permit, you must pass the test at least 80% accuracy. If you fail the test, you are able to take the test again after 6 hours.
Once you have a permit, you have to carry it with you at all times when riding a motorcycle. You must wear a helmet, and abide by the New York State laws regarding passenger riders. The vehicle must also be equipped with footrests that are accessible to both the driver and passenger. Additionally, the motorcycle must be fitted with a number plate and approved lights.
To qualify for an official Motorcycle License (Class M) you must be at least 18 years old. You may have to take an Rider Education or Driver Education course, depending on your age and experience. You may be able waive this requirement if you hold a license from another state.
You must also submit documents that prove your identity and residence. You can use your birth certificate, passport or other ID issued by the government. You'll need to provide proof of your residence at the address, like a utility bill or a rental agreement. In addition, you will need to provide your Social Security number.
